Ashley Jacobson is a Licensed Clinical Professional Counselor (LCPC),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C), and National Board Certified Counselor (NBCC) with a Master’s Degree in Clinical Psychology from Rosalind Franklin University. She specializes in working with individuals navigating anxiety, depression, OCD, trauma, addiction, grief and loss, and thought disorders, with a particular focus on psychedelic-assisted therapy and ketamine integration support. Ashley was the first student at Rosalind Franklin University to develop and teach a graduate-level course on psychedelics and graduated with a specialty in Psychedelic Therapy.

Ashley takes a compassionate, individualized approach to care, drawing from psychodynamic therapy, c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T), and harm reduction principles. She is passionate about creating a safe, nonjudgmental environment where patients feel supported exploring their experiences, processing grief and life transitions, building resilience, and working toward meaningful healing and personal growth.

She has extensive experience helping patients prepare for and integrate psychedelic-assisted therapies in a thoughtful and grounded way. Ashley works closely with individuals to help them better understand themselves, process difficult experiences, and apply insights from therapy into their everyday lives with greater clarity, balance, and intention.
